South Dakota bird hunters getting boost from delayed crop harvest

Game, Fish & Parks reports strong pheasant hunting numbers in first days of 2025 season

South Dakota’s slow-moving fall harvest is helping hunters find plenty of pheasants in the field in the early days of the new hunting season.

According to the South Dakota Game, Fish & Parks Department, hunters are reporting an abundance of birds on the landscape. And despite windy conditions since the season opener last Saturday making hunting more challenging, early results have been “extremely promising.”
